English

Etymology

From fish + -like.

Adjective

fishlike (comparative more fishlike, superlative most fishlike)

  1. Having some characteristics of a fish.
    fishlike scales
    fishlike eyes
    fishlike swimming ability
    fishlike smell
    • 1989, Octavia E. Butler, “Part III, Chapter 7”, in Imago, page 213:
      His skin was as scaly as those of some fish I'd seen. His nose was distorted—flattened from having been broken several times—and that enhanced his fishlike appearance.
    • 2013, F. Crescitelli, The Visual System in Vertebrates, page 27:
      The most striking marine reptiles are the fishlike or porpoiselike ichthyosaurs.
